Langkawi

Langkawi is a popular area of Malaysia. Langkawi means “tropical paradise,” which is a befitting name for the region. Technically an archipelago, Langkawi features natural jungles, pristine beaches and clear, blue waters. Since 1986, the district has been duty-free, making it a shopper’s paradise. Additionally, the islands are peppered with spas, beach bars, seafood restaurants, and cafés. Residents are friendly and engage in conversations with tourists, making it a favorite destination among families and those who enjoy social interaction with new people.

Tioman

Travelers often described beautiful Tioman as having a Polynesian ambiance, with its coral-rich waters, steep green mountains and abundant hibiscus flowers. The island is spacious and attracts approximately 200,000 beachcombers every year. vacationers frequently describe the area as natural and unspoiled, somewhat like a “friendly wilderness.”

A short stretch of highway runs along the island’s western side from Berjaya Beach to the north end of Tekek, where a stone staircase interrupts it before it continues it’s path to the end of the Air Batang Coast, also called “ABC” by locals. Tekek is the largest village in Tioman and its administrative center. There is also an airport located in Tekek, as well as the island’s only ATM machine. Tioman is also popular among golfers, and because of the island’s tropical climate, the game can be enjoyed year-round.

Pulau Pangkor

Pulau Pangkor has a long and interesting history, beginning with its name, which means “beautiful island.” Although it is popular among all vacationers, history buffs particularly enjoy visiting interesting landmarks and attractions on this former pirate hideout island. In the 17th century, a large fort was built on Pulau Pangkor by the Dutch during their battle to control the Strait of Melaka, an area that goes from the island to the mainland. However, they lost this war and several decades later a treaty was signed between Great Britain and a Dutch contender from Perak. Since then, the fort was used as part of an effort made by island residents to monopolize the tin trade in Malaysia. Many fascinating landmarks such as the Dutch fort are found on Pulau Pangkor, and numerous travellers enjoy exploring them all during their holiday.

Seribuat Archipelago

The Seribuat Archipelago is a group of 64 islands scattered off Johor’s east coast. It is often described as a constellation of Malaysia’s loveliest islands. Numerous individuals visit the Archipelago for its tranquility and slow-paced environment, and it is certainly a good choice for such travelers. Those whose goal is rest and relaxation should definitely consider visiting Seribuat for their next holiday.

The Seribuat Archipelago is also a diverse haven for sea-life enthusiasts and features a vast array of marine life and coral formations. Barracuda, butterfly fish, giant clams and parrot fish are just a few of the species that are easily seen from the waters surrounding the Archipelago. Serious divers should invest in a Marine Parks pass at the jetty in Mersing, as this is the most cost-effective way to enjoy a diving excursion in the area.
